Job Overview

This is an exciting opportunity to join the merge Financial Management Team responsible for, among others, financial performance analysis, budgeting, financial planning and forecasting. The Financial Management Team supports a diversified group of operational and clinical leaders on the day-to-day budgetary management performance as well as strategic financial decisions.

As a Senior Finance Manager with the Financial Management function, you will play a central role in integration and alignment of two merging Management Accounts Team. The post holder will act as the central point for coordination across Divisional Management Accounts Teams, ensuring outputs are accurate, standardised, delivered to deadline and audit-ready. This role will also provide strong people leadership, ensuring Divisional Management Accounts Team operates effectively, consistently, and in line with the Trust’s standards. It will be an excellent opportunity to embed a culture of continuous improvement and implement the changes across a wide range of processes and reports.

Main duties of the job

  • To provide financial reporting and analysis to support Head of Management Accounts in the development and delivery of the financial and operational plan as well as the production of budget, monthly reporting pack and ad-hoc consolidation reports on Trust-wide projects.
  • To provide expert accounting and business knowledge, analytical support and clear presentation of financial and business information to clinical and non-clinical colleagues.
  • To support in ensuring that the team of Divisional Finance Managers work in a consistent way by supporting their ongoing professional development, through improvement of policies and procedures.
  • To support Head of Management Account in the delivery of the Trust’s financial management training programme for non-finance staff including the design of training material and facilitation and presentation at training events under supervision when suitable.

Bristol NHS Foundation Trust brings together more than 28,000 staff to deliver over 160 clinical services across thirteen hospital locations, operating from three main sites at Southmead, Bristol city centre and Weston.

With an annual turnover of £2.3 billion, we are now one of the largest NHS trusts in the United Kingdom.
